WitrynaThese same pine forests were also valued for timber, because the same resins that made longleaf pine valuable in the production of tar and turpentine helped preserve the pine and prevent rot. In the 19 th century, enslaved labour was a critically important part of the timber industry in the southern US (Clark, 1972). Thus, even though Bermuda ...
